After any incident, it's vital to protect your rights. This includes assembling evidence, obtaining medical attention, and noting all facts. Avoid approving any papers without consulting an attorney. It's also important to notify the proper officials about the accident. By taking these steps, you can confirm that your legal standing are protected. Remember, knowledge of your rights is essential in navigating the challenges of an accident case.
